Web サイトの読み込み速度は、その成功に重要な役割を果たします。読み込みが遅い Web サイトは、訪問者を落胆させ、収益に影響を与えます。 WordPress サイトが最適に動作していることを確認するには、サーバーの初期応答時間を短縮するための措置を講じることが不可欠です。この記事では、この目標を達成するためのさまざまな方法と、それがユーザー エクスペリエンスに与える影響について説明します。
1. 高品質のホスティング プロバイダーを利用して、応答時間が速く信頼できることを確認します。優れたパフォーマンスとアップタイムを提供する強力な実績を持つものを探してください。可能であれば、環境をより細かく制御できる VPS や専用サーバー ホスティング プランを選択し、必要に応じてカスタマイズできるようにします。
2. 最適化されたコンテンツ配信ネットワーク (CDN) を使用して、画像、CSS、JavaScript などの静的ファイルを世界中の複数のデータ センターにキャッシュすることで、世界中にすばやく配信します。これにより、特に遠く離れた場所からアクセスしている場合に、ユーザーのアクセス時間が短縮され、待ち時間が短縮されます。
3. 可能な場合は JavaScript と CSS ファイルを 1 つのドキュメントに結合するか、事前に縮小されている jQuery などのライブラリを使用して、HTTP 要求を最小限に抑えます。さらに、遅延読み込みなどの手法を使用すると、最初のページの読み込みが正常に完了するまで特定の要素を延期することで、ページの読み込みに必要なリクエストの数を大幅に減らすことができます。
データベースの最適化は、WordPress の初期サーバー応答時間を短縮するための重要な手段です。ページの読み込み時間を短縮し、ユーザー エクスペリエンスを向上させるのに役立ちます。データベースを最適化するには、使用されなくなった不要なプラグインとテーマを無効にすることから始めます。これにより、データベースのサイズを縮小し、読み込み速度を向上させることができます。さらに、テーブルの最適化は、クエリが送信されたときの応答時間を短縮するために、冗長なデータを消去し、既存のエントリを圧縮するのにも役立つため、有益です。また、オブジェクトが要求されるたびにデータベースから再ロードするのではなく、オブジェクトをメモリに格納するために、可能な場合はオブジェクト キャッシュを有効にする必要があります。これにより、パフォーマンスが大幅に向上します。最後に、独自のサーバーへのデータ要求を待つのではなく、キャッシュされたコンテンツをサーバーから直接提供するのに役立つ CDN (コンテンツ配信ネットワーク) を設定することを検討してください。これにより、読み込み時間が短縮されます。
キャッシュは、WordPress でサーバーの初期応答時間を短縮する優れた方法です。リクエストをキャッシュすることで、WordPress が同じページを複数回処理する必要がなくなります。これにより、サーバーの応答時間が大幅に短縮され、ユーザーはより速くページにアクセスできるようになります。
オブジェクト キャッシング、データベース キャッシング、ページ キャッシングなど、いくつかの異なるタイプのキャッシングを使用できます。オブジェクト キャッシングは、既に行われたクエリからのデータをメモリに保存するため、リクエストが行われるたびに再クエリを実行する必要はありません。データベース キャッシングはクエリ結果のデータを保存するため、誰かがサイトにアクセスしたときに再度クエリを実行する必要はありません。最後に、ページ キャッシングはページまたは投稿の静的コピーを保存するため、誰かがあなたのサイトにアクセスしたときに、リクエストが行われるたびに WordPress がコンテンツを生成するのを待つのではなく、それらのページをすぐに表示できます。
これらのさまざまな種類のキャッシュを利用することで、リクエストが迅速かつ効率的に処理されるようにすると同時に、誰かが Web サイトにアクセスするたびに処理されるクエリが少なくなるため、ホスティング環境への負担を軽減できます。
コンテンツ配信ネットワーク (CDN) は、Web 最適化の強力なツールです。静的コンテンツをキャッシュし、ユーザーに最も近いさまざまな地理的な場所から提供することで、サーバーの初期応答時間を短縮するのに役立ちます。このようにすると、ユーザーは自分の場所とオリジン サーバーの間で要求がやり取りされるのを待つ必要がないため、ページをすばやく取得できます。さらに、CDN はホスティング プロバイダーから負荷をオフロードし、レイテンシの増加につながるトラフィックの急増を防ぎます。 CDN を設定するときは、画像、JavaScript ファイル、CSS スタイルシートなど、WordPress 内のすべての静的ファイルが CDN を介して提供されるようにする必要があります。さらに、訪問者が以前にダウンロードしたリソースにサーバーから再度要求することなくアクセスできるように、ブラウザのキャッシュも利用する必要があります。
4. HTTP リクエストを最小限に抑える
5. 画像の圧縮とサイズ変更
6.Gzip圧縮を有効にする
7. プラグインとテーマを最適化する
結論: よりスムーズなパフォーマンス
コメントを残す